Sri Lanka mulls making tourist spots zero emission zones

Sri Lanka’s government is considering transforming tourist zones into “Zero Emission” zones in the future, the government information department has said.

“The necessary background and possibilities for this have already been explored, and it is expected that this eco-friendly approach will give new life to the green tourism industry in Sri Lanka.”

Steps to promote environmentally friendly electric vehicles (EVs) in tourist zones are being considered, according to the statement.

“The primary hope is to transform these unique tourist zones into “Zero Emission” zones in the future, utilizing various investments and practical programs.”
